Bedford county tennessee dp 2 profile of selected social characteristics
| Number | Percent |
SCHOOL ENROLLMENT | ||
---|---|---|
Population 3 years and over enrolled in school | 8,678 | 100.0 |
Nursery school, preschool | 624 | 7.2 |
Kindergarten | 665 | 7.7 |
Elementary school (grades 1-8) | 4,297 | 49.5 |
High school (grades 9-12) | 2,126 | 24.5 |
College or graduate school | 966 | 11.1 |
EDUCATIONAL ATTAINMENT | ||
Population 25 years and over | 24,232 | 100.0 |
Less than 9th grade | 3,298 | 13.6 |
9th to 12th grade, no diploma | 4,044 | 16.7 |
High school graduate (includes equivalency) | 9,442 | 39.0 |
Some college, no degree | 3,875 | 16.0 |
Associate degree | 875 | 3.6 |
Bachelor's degree | 1,831 | 7.6 |
Graduate or professional degree | 867 | 3.6 |
Percent high school graduate or higher | 69.7 | (X) |
Percent bachelor's degree or higher | 11.1 | (X) |
MARITAL STATUS | ||
Population 15 years and over | 29,514 | 100.0 |
Never married | 6,184 | 21.0 |
Now married, except separated | 17,725 | 60.1 |
Separated | 600 | 2.0 |
Widowed | 1,933 | 6.5 |
Female | 1,654 | 5.6 |
Divorced | 3,072 | 10.4 |
Female | 1,677 | 5.7 |
